Halloween Bean for Font Pairing and Brand Consistency

One of the most important aspects of using Halloween Bean effectively is pairing it with complementary fonts. Since it’s a decorative display font, it works best when balanced with a simpler typeface. For example, pairing Halloween Bean with a modern sans serif like Montserrat or a classic serif like Playfair Display creates a clean, professional contrast that enhances readability and visual hierarchy.

Whether you're designing product packaging, social media posts, or print ads, consistent font use helps reinforce your brand identity. Halloween Bean gives your business a seasonal personality while still allowing room for a polished, cohesive look.
